Transaction 32f2996726892e08537ddf7737ef76c69939d64e5cfc32280fc6eb6b00073eaf
2 Input
2 Outputs
- 32f2996726892e08537ddf7737ef76c69939d64e5cfc32280fc6eb6b00073eaf:0
- 32f2996726892e08537ddf7737ef76c69939d64e5cfc32280fc6eb6b00073eaf:1
value 506120
address 1LvD9MwL5tcWXYkEtrxTYJr2YGmyJzrcu2
value 1801634
address 3Hvh6keQRi6WpyU6ZsqC6K8tUppkYP74pP